The impact you’ll make The Supplier Engineer and the Sr. Manager role are part of the Supplier Engineering and Technology team. SET is an organization that is innovative in manufacturing technology, materials and supply chain design. As a Supplier Engineering Sr. Manager, you will have a vital role within the Gas integration and Gas OEM spaces as well as the success of the overall team and commodity. You will have the opportunity to work across organizational functions to resolve technical, quality and production challenges, as well as opportunity to develop excellence in product design and manufacturing. Candidate should be a result-driven, self-starter possessing strong interpersonal skills with a strong focus on supporting internal and external customers. This individual should also possess the 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ment, to adapt to changing priorities and to work independently in a close-knit team setting.
Job Responsibility
Work with Lam Product Group Engineering organizations in development and release of new integrated assemblies & OEM products to the supply base – Gas Delivery and OEM Components
Apply skills and experience with semiconductor manufacturing and equipment to technical and quality problems encountered in the product life cycle with special attention to new product introduction
Coordinate and support investigation of key quality defects of components from the customers and/or field service team to drive corrective actions and continuous improvement
Drive the improvement of the remote factory suppliers’ quality and manufacturing processes to ensure product quality, cost, and on-time-delivery
Act as liaison / technical lead for cross functional projects to include Build Verify and Production Readiness Review
Audit and document supply base performance on critical process of records and overall quality management systems
Collaborate on the continuous development of supply base through close teamwork with product management, global product group, and supplier business managers
Leads, and is personally accountable for, high profile project timelines and milestones
Continuously working on process improvement and developing Best Known Methods
Provide technical support in Build, Test and FQA to suppliers in deposition and etch product deployment and transition
Perform Standardized Supplier Quality Audits and administer Supplier Quality Scorecard for existing suppliers to promote continuous improvement
Drive Root Cause and Corrective Action Analysis on defects and Escalations
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Materials, Chemistry or Mechanical Engineering from accredited University
Five years of people management experience with Eight years of working in the Semiconductor Equipment Industry
Creative thinking and strong problem solving and troubleshooting capabilities, including experience in the areas of gas delivery integration and OEM gas components
Solid understanding of fluid mechanics, thermodynamics, mass/momentum/heat transfer
Solid understanding of statistical process control and basic statistical analysis used in production setting
Solid understanding of equipment and component manufacturing processes
Experience in supplier process development & quality management
Understanding of failure analysis and problem solving
Ability to learn new skills quickly with minimal guidance
International & domestic travelling
Mechanical/fluid delivery system design
Systems engineering, integration and customer fab knowledge
Solid understanding of various problem-solving methodologies to include 8-D/5 why
Project Management / Team Lead experience
Experience with working with global suppliers
Effective verbal and written communication and presentation skills
